Add 12/24 and 35/45
12/24 + 35/45 is 23/18.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 24 and 45 is 360
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 360 - For the 1st fraction, since 24 × 15 = 360,
12/24 = 12 × 15/24 × 15 = 180/360 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 8 = 360,
35/45 = 35 × 8/45 × 8 = 280/360 - Add the two like fractions:
180/360 + 280/360 = 180 + 280/360 = 460/360 - 460/360 simplified gives 23/18
- So, 12/24 + 35/45 = 23/18
